Course Description | |||||||
![]() |
|||||||
![]() |
|||||||
Almost everything that goes on in classrooms is prompted, shaped, and expressed by language, and the analysis of classroom discourse has become an important tool in educational research. This course examines discourse analysis as a research method and teaches techniques of discourse transcription and analysis for use in qualitative research. The course reviews theories of discourse and focuses on key concepts and methods for analyzing discourses. Assignments include responses to readings, transcriptions of audio taped or videotaped discourses and analyses of discourses such as small-group discussions, classroom scenes, in-depth interviews, and naturally occurring conversations. | |||||||
